They can be pretty good and convenient. Not all ophthalmologists will do them, a lot refuse to do them because some people can be unhappy with them due to halos and expense. Although they are multifocals and you should be able to see good at all distances, some of the time people also need to still get some reading glasses for fine work or if you’re reading/doing near work for extended periods of time. Most of the time for regular everyday tasks you can get away without the readers.

Hey so I work in this industry. I have seen a handful of people who are really unhappy but also quite a few that are very happy. Personally, I wouldn’t do it. The ones that I’ve seen that don’t go well really puts me off. On top of that, it’s not a life long fix. You are most likely going to need glasses again within 5-10 years. So it’s very expensive for only 5-10 years of great vision. I’d have a talk with your optometrist, you may be able to go with another option such as a lensectomy (this is what they do when you get cataracts removed). Essentially what they do is remove the natural lens of the eye and replace it with an implant. This is the most common eye surgery (as basically everyone gets cataracts when they are older) and it is typically very successful. Of course there are some bad stories as all surgeries have. Have a look into it and talk with your optometrist, might be what you’re after. Also make sure you look for a good ophthalmologist, there’s some not so great ones around.
